Trip Itinerary
DAY 01
Delhi - Haridwar (260km | 07 hours
  • Upon your arrival in Delhi, our representative will receive you at the airport or railway station. From here, begin your comfortable drive towards Haridwar, the gateway to the Char Dham Yatra.
  • After arrival, check in to your hotel and relax after the journey.
  • In the evening (subject to your arrival time and preference), visit the sacred Har Ki Pauri to witness the mesmerizing Ganga Aarti — a soulful ceremony dedicated to Mother Ganga. The rhythmic chants, glowing diyas, and spiritual energy create a truly divine experience.
  • Return to the hotel for dinner and overnight stay in Haridwar.

🍽️ Meals: Dinner

🏨 Stay: Haridwar

DAY 02
Haridwar - Barkot (205km | 8hours)
  • After breakfast, begin your scenic drive towards Barkot, a peaceful hill town nestled amidst the Garhwal Himalayas and the base for your Yamunotri visit.
  • The journey takes you through winding mountain roads, lush valleys, and beautiful countryside landscapes, offering a gradual transition into the higher Himalayan region.
  • Upon arrival in Barkot, check in to your hotel and take time to relax and acclimatize. The rest of the day is at leisure to unwind and prepare for the spiritual excursion ahead.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Stay: Barkot

DAY 03
Barkot - Yamunotri - Barkot (45km | 6km trek each)
  • Early morning (around 4:00 AM), proceed for a scenic drive to Janki Chatti, the starting point of the trek to Yamunotri Temple.
  • From Janki Chatti, begin the 6 km trek (one way) towards Yamunotri. You may choose to walk at your own pace or hire a pony, palki/doli (at additional cost) for a more comfortable ascent.
  • Upon reaching Yamunotri, take a holy dip in the sacred Surya Kund (hot spring) or in the cool waters of the Yamuna River, as per tradition. Visit the Yamunotri Temple for darshan and perform pooja of Maa Yamuna at the revered Divya Shila.
  • After seeking blessings, trek back to Janki Chatti and later drive back to Barkot.
  • Upon arrival, relax at the hotel after a spiritually uplifting and physically fulfilling day.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Stay: Barkot

DAY 4
Barkot - Uttarkashi (100km | 4hours)
  • After breakfast (around 9:00 AM), check out from the hotel and begin your scenic drive towards Uttarkashi, a serene town situated along the banks of the Bhagirathi River and an important stop on the Char Dham route.
  • En route, visit the sacred Kashi Vishwanath Temple, one of the oldest and most revered temples dedicated to Lord Shiva in the region. Seek blessings and spend some peaceful moments at this spiritually significant shrine.
  • Upon arrival in Uttarkashi, check in to your hotel and relax. The rest of the day is at leisure to unwind and prepare for the Gangotri visit the following day.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Stay: Uttarkashi

DAY 05
Uttarkashi - Gangotri - Uttarkashi (100km | 3hours)
  • After breakfast, proceed for a full-day excursion to Gangotri Temple, one of the sacred Char Dham shrines and the origin of the holy River Ganga.
  • The drive itself is breathtaking as you pass through the picturesque Harsil Valley, known for its apple orchards, deodar forests, and serene Himalayan charm. Enjoy stunning views of the Bhagirathi River flowing alongside and the majestic snow-clad peaks in the backdrop.
  • Upon arrival in Gangotri, visit the Gangotri Mata Temple for darshan and pooja. You may also explore the sacred Bhagirath Shila and Surya Kund, both holding immense mythological and spiritual significance.
  • After seeking blessings and spending peaceful moments by the river, drive back to Uttarkashi.
  • Relax at your hotel after a spiritually enriching day.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Stay: Uttarkashi

DAY 06
Uttarkashi - Guptkashi (200km | 7hours)
  • Early morning (around 6:00 AM) after breakfast, check out from your hotel in Uttarkashi and begin your scenic drive towards Guptkashi.
  • En route, visit the sacred Devprayag, the divine confluence where the Alaknanda and Bhagirathi rivers merge to form the holy Ganga River. Spend some peaceful moments witnessing this spiritually powerful Sangam and capture memorable photographs.
  • Continue your journey and stop at the revered Dhari Devi Temple, one of the most significant Shakti Peeths of Uttarakhand. Seek blessings at the temple, beautifully located on the banks of the Alaknanda River.
  • Thereafter, proceed towards Guptkashi. Upon arrival, check in to your hotel and relax. The evening is at leisure to unwind and prepare for the Kedarnath journey ahead.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Overnight Stay: Guptkashi

DAY 07
Guptkashi - Sonprayag - Gaurikund - Kedarnath (35km | 20km trek)
  • Early morning, proceed by road to Sonprayag, as private vehicles are permitted only up to this point.
  • From Sonprayag, take a local union vehicle to Gaurikund (approx. 3 kms | direct payment basis | approx. INR 200 per person).
  • Upon arrival at Gaurikund, begin your sacred trek towards Kedarnath Temple. The beautifully developed trekking route winds through majestic Himalayan landscapes, flowing waterfalls, and spiritual chants that energise every step of your journey.
  • After reaching Kedarnath, check in to your accommodation and relax. Later, visit the temple for divine darshan and immerse yourself in the spiritually uplifting evening aarti — a truly unforgettable experience in the lap of the Himalayas.

🏔️ Overnight Stay: Kedarnath

DAY 08
Kedarnath - Gaurikund - Sonprayag - Guptkashi (35km | 2hours)
  • Early morning (around 7:00 AM), check out from your accommodation in Kedarnath. After capturing a few memorable photographs and soaking in the final divine views of Kedarnath Temple, begin your trek downhill towards Gaurikund.
  • Upon reaching Gaurikund, take a local union vehicle to Sonprayag (approx. 3 kms | direct payment basis | approx. INR 200 per person).
  • From Sonprayag, drive back to Guptkashi. On arrival, check in to your hotel and relax after the spiritually fulfilling yet physically demanding journey.

🍽️ Meals: Dinner

🏨 Overnight Stay: Guptkashi

DAY 09
Guptkashi - Badrinath (200km | 8hours)
  • Post breakfast, check out from your hotel and begin your scenic drive towards Badrinath Temple.
  • En route, enjoy a beautiful drive through Chopta, often referred to as the “Mini Switzerland of India,” surrounded by dense forests and breathtaking Himalayan views.
  • Continue towards Joshimath and visit the sacred Narsingh Temple, an important temple dedicated to Lord Vishnu and believed to be closely associated with Badrinath.
  • Upon arrival in Badrinath, check in to your hotel and relax. In the evening, visit Badrinath Temple for darshan and attend the divine evening aarti (subject to time availability).
  • Important Note: We highly recommend booking an online pooja in advance to avoid long queues and ensure a smoother darshan experience.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Overnight Stay: Badrinath

DAY 10
Badrinath - Rishikesh (280km | 12hours)
  • Early morning, take a holy dip in Tapt Kund, the natural thermal spring near the temple, and proceed for darshan at the sacred Badrinath Temple.
  • Devotees may also seek the rare Brahma Kamal flower, considered highly significant for performing Pind Daan and Shradh rituals for ancestors (Pitru).
  • After darshan, explore the nearby attractions located within 3 kms of Badrinath:

Mana Village – The last Indian village near the Indo-Tibetan border

Vyas Gufa – The cave where Sage Vyas is believed to have composed the Mahabharata

Mata Murti Temple

Bhim Kund

The origin (“Mukh”) of the Saraswati River and Saraswati Temple

  • After completing the sightseeing, drive towards Rudraprayag or Rishikesh.
  • Upon arrival, check in to your hotel and relax after a spiritually fulfilling day.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ast & Dinner

🏨 Overnight Stay: Rishikesh

DAY 11
Rishikesh
  • After breakfast, enjoy a relaxed day exploring the spiritual charm of Rishikesh, known as the Yoga Capital of the World.
  • Visit the iconic suspension bridges — Ram Jhula and Lakshman Jhula — offering scenic views of the holy Ganges and the surrounding temples and ashrams.
  • Spend peaceful moments at Triveni Ghat, one of the most sacred bathing ghats in Rishikesh. In the evening, you may witness the divine Ganga Aarti, a spiritually uplifting experience with devotional chants and floating diyas.
  • You can also explore nearby temples, yoga ashrams, cafés, or simply relax by the river soaking in the serene Himalayan atmosphere.
  • The rest of the day is at leisure to unwind after your sacred Char Dham journey.

🍽️ Meals: Breakfast 

🏨 Overnight Stay: Rishikesh

DAY 12
Rishikesh - Delhi (280km | 6hours)
  • Check out from your hotel in Rishikesh and begin your return journey to Delhi.
  • Enjoy the scenic drive back as your spiritually enriching Char Dham journey comes to a memorable conclusion.
  • Upon arrival in Delhi, our representative will assist you with a comfortable drop at the railway station or airport for your onward journey.
  • Your sacred journey concludes with divine blessings and unforgettable Himalayan memories.

Things To Carry
  • Clothing - Warm jackets (preferably down / heavy woollen), thermal wear (upper & lower), sweaters / hoodies, comfortable trekking pants, full sleeve t-shirts, nightwear, extra pair of socks (woollen recommended) & raincoat / poncho (weather can change suddenly).
  • Footwear - Good quality trekking shoes with strong grip, slippers / floaters for hotel use & extra pair of socks.
  • Accessories - Woollen cap / monkey cap, gloves, sunglasses (UV protected), sunscreen (SPF 30+), lip balm & moisturizer, small backpack (for trek day essentials).
  • Medicines - Personal prescribed medicines, basic medication for headache, cold, fever , ORS sachets, pain relief spray, band-aids, portable oxygen can (optional but useful for high altitude).
  • Documents - Government ID proof (Aadhar / Passport / DL).
  • Trek Essentials - Reusable water bottle, energy bars / dry fruits, torch / headlamp, power bank , wet wipes / tissues.
  • Important Notes - Avoid heavy luggage — carry only essentials, pack light for the Kedarnath trek & weather in Kedarnath can drop below 5°C even in summer.

FAQ's

How many days are enough for Char Dham?

Approximately 11-12 days

 

Which is difficult in Char Dham Yatra?

Kedarnath is one of the toughest.

Which month is better for Char Dham Yatra ?

April – May – June are the best months for Char Dham Yatra.
